  • Crack Repair - needed when concrete floors develop cracks that could compromise structural integrity or safety.
  • Spalling Repair - required if surface layers of concrete begin to flake or peel, often due to moisture or wear.
  • Surface Restoration - suitable for floors showing signs of wear, discoloration, or surface damage needing resurfacing.
  • Joint and Seam Repair - necessary when expansion joints or seams become damaged or lose their effectiveness.
  • Resurfacing and Overlay - used to improve the appearance and durability of worn or stained industrial floors.

Industrial floor repair services involve restoring and maintaining the integrity of large-scale flooring systems used in commercial, manufacturing, warehouse, and industrial facilities. These services typically include crack filling, surface leveling, epoxy coating application, and patching damaged sections. The goal is to improve the durability, safety, and appearance of the flooring to ensure it can withstand heavy use, machinery, and the weight of stored goods. Professionals working on industrial floors assess the existing surface to determine the most appropriate repair methods and materials to address specific issues effectively.

These repair services help resolve common problems such as cracks, surface spalling, unevenness, and wear caused by constant traffic and heavy machinery. Over time, industrial floors may develop cracks or become uneven, which can pose safety hazards and disrupt operations. Repairing these issues helps prevent further deterioration, reduces the risk of accidents, and extends the lifespan of the flooring. Additionally, many repair solutions incorporate protective coatings that resist chemicals, spills, and abrasions, further enhancing the floor’s resilience.

Industries that utilize industrial floor repair services often include manufacturing plants, warehouses, distribution centers, automotive facilities, and large retail spaces. These properties typically feature expansive concrete or epoxy-coated floors that endure significant stress and exposure to harsh conditions. Property owners and managers seek professional repair services to maintain the safety and functionality of their floors, minimize downtime, and avoid costly replacements or extensive renovations. Regular maintenance and timely repairs are essential for preserving the operational efficiency of these large-scale properties.

The overview below groups typical Industrial Floor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Columbus, OH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Repair Costs - The cost for industrial floor repairs typically ranges from $2 to $8 per square foot, depending on the extent of damage and materials used. For example, a 1,000-square-foot area might cost between $2,000 and $8,000 to repair.

Resurfacing Expenses - Resurfacing or coating industrial floors can cost approximately $3 to $10 per square foot. For a 2,000-square-foot area, this could amount to $6,000 to $20,000, based on the chosen finish and surface condition.

Crack and Damage Repair - Addressing cracks and localized damage often costs between $150 and $500 per repair, with larger or more complex repairs potentially exceeding that range. The overall expense depends on the severity and number of repairs needed.

Material and Labor Factors - Costs vary based on the type of repair materials, such as epoxy or polyurethane coatings, and the labor involved. Typical projects in Columbus, OH, fall within standard industry price ranges, but specific quotes depend on project details.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of flooring can be repaired? Local contractors typically repair various types of industrial flooring, including concrete, epoxy, and resin floors, to address cracks, spalling, or surface damage.

How long does industrial floor repair usually take? Repair times vary depending on the extent of damage and the type of flooring, but many projects can be completed within a few days.

Is surface preparation necessary before repair? Yes, proper surface preparation, such as cleaning and removing damaged material, is essential to ensure a durable and effective repair.

Can damaged floors be reinforced during repair? Many contractors offer reinforcement options, such as overlays or reinforcements, to improve the strength and longevity of the repaired surface.

What maintenance is recommended after repair? Regular inspections and prompt attention to minor issues can help maintain the integrity of the repaired flooring over time.
